 Wanstead and Letonstone. East End's Free Art & History.
Wanstead is mentioned in the Domesday Book as a manor previously held by St Paul (later known as St Paul's Cathedral) but at the time of the survey belonging to Ranulf Fitz Brien.
In Wanstead Park on the edge of one of the ornamental lakes there is a structure in the form of a grotto with a small inlet behind as it was also used as a boat house.
When building work was carried out on Wanstead House in the 18th century a mosaic was found measuring 20 foot by 16 foot depicting a man and a horse; but at that time they did not think that it was something that they ought to preserve.

 EoLFHS Parishes: Wanstead
Wanstead, Essex, lies on the right of the Chigwell road, between it and the river Roding, about 3 miles beyond Stratford, and 6 miles from Whitechapel church by road; ½ mile southeast of the Snaresbrook Station of the Great Eastern Railway (Ongar line).
Within the park stands Wanstead Church (of the Virgin Mary), built 1787-90, at the cost of Sir James Tylney-Long in place of the old parish church, which was small, inconvenient, and dilapidated.
On the west of Wanstead Park, divided from it by the road to Snaresbrook, remains what looks like a wild bit of the Forest, but having avenues across it, the chief nearly a mile long -no doubt relies of the old avenues of Sir Josiah Child's planting.

 The Royal Wanstead Foundation
The Royal Wanstead Foundation (RWF) is a registered charity and the modern successor of an institution founded in 1827 as the Infant Orphan Asylum by the Victorian philanthropist Dr Andrew Reed.
Following the closure of the Royal Wanstead School at Snaresbrook in 1971 (and the closure of the girls’ school at Sawbridgeworth two years earlier), the Foundation continues the work begun by Andrew Reed 144 years ago, by supporting children at a wide range of appropriate boarding schools up and down the UK.
The RWF seeks to maintain reserves sufficient to sustain the Foundation’s charitable work indefinitely, recognising: that school fees have tended to increase faster than inflation; that Stock Market investments are cyclical; and that medium-term continuity in grant-making is necessary in order to avoid disturbing the security of the children whose education the Foundation supports.

 Subterranea Britannica: Research Study Group: Sites: Wanstead
With the re-emergence of civil defence in the early 1950s, four of the sectors were provided with war rooms originally known as ``sub-regional commissioner's offices''.
These four London group controls were identical and were located at: Partingdale Lane; Mill Hill (opposite the barracks and next to the sub-station just on the bend), Northumberland Avenue; Wanstead (behind the council estate) Kemnal Manor; Chislehurst (a long way down Kemnal Road) Church Hill Road; Cheam (next to Queen Victoria pub).
The NE Group War Room at Wanstead was demolished in 2000 and the site is now occupied by a nursing home.
